Videos depict crows inserting trash items like cigarette butts into a vending machine to receive food rewards as part of the corvid cleaning project founded by robert andersson. the initiative was piloted by the city of södertälje during science week in 2022 but was not continued. Sweden has turned waste importation into a lucrative industry that generates substantial revenue. sweden is not only saving money by replacing fossil fuel with waste to produce energy; it is generating 100 million usd annually by importing trash and recycling the waste produced by other countries.
